Customised office popular
- Published: 20/09/2011 at 02:56 AM
- Newspaper section: Business
The build-to-suit office building has emerged as an alternative for companies that require specific features but would rather not invest in developing their own buildings, says Jones Lang LaSalle, a professional services firm specialising in real estate.
The option allows the tenant to design a new facility without having to build and own the premises, and at the same time ensures a steady income stream for the developer.
Michael Tang, the head of project and development services at Jones Lang LaSalle, says the trend is catching on in countries all over Asia, including Singapore, China, India, Malaysia and Indonesia.
